What You’ll Do
• Provide comprehensive, compassionate care to patients and their families in their home or facility setting.
• Assess and coordinate individualized plans of care that address physical, emotional, and spiritual needs.
• Mentor and train new nurses and team members, ensuring consistent, high-quality care across all cases.
• Teach hospice philosophy, pain and symptom management, and best practices in communication and patient advocacy.
• Collaborate closely with physicians, social workers, and other interdisciplinary team members to support holistic patient care.
• Offer emotional support to families and perform bereavement assessments following patient loss.
What You’ll Need
• Graduate of an accredited nursing program (Associate, Diploma, or Bachelor’s).
• Current Registered Nurse (RN) license in the state of practice.
• Minimum of one year of clinical experience — hospice or home health preferred.
• Strong communication skills and a passion for teaching and mentorship.
• Valid driver’s license, auto insurance, and reliable transportation.
• Ability to lift, stand, and move intermittently; capable of lifting up to 100 lbs.

About Elara Caring
Elara Caring is a leading provider of personalized in-home care services across the United States. With a presence in the Northeast, Midwest, and Southwest regions, Elara Caring has a dedicated team of 26,000 caregivers who cater to over 60,000 patients daily. Committed to delivering the 'right care, at the right time, in the right place,' the company operates in 225 locations spanning 16 states.
